The 1001 on the right is a bypass that connects to the main 1001 on the left. it connects at Mae Jo U. The 1001 on the left is the only road known as the Mae Jo Highway . You will find in Thailand that roads or highways that are numbered will normally have a second road in the area with the same number, these are bypass roads but their highway signs or maps do not state this so it can be confusing.
